The invention discloses a three-engine/double-engine configuration helicopter engine power balancing method and device. According to the method, balancing is achieved through an engine power control system. The method comprises the steps that a cockpit power balancing switch is in a torque balancing gear in a default mode; when a pilot observes that the engines work, the difference value of the gas turbine outlet temperatures ITT of the two engines or the three engines is smaller than a preset temperature threshold value, and the percentage difference value of Ng is smaller than a preset rotating speed threshold value, a cockpit power balancing switch is not operated, and the current torque balancing state is kept; when a pilot observes that the ITT difference value between the different engines is larger than a preset temperature threshold value and the NG percentage difference value is larger than a preset rotating speed threshold value, it is considered that the performance difference between the different engines is large, and a cockpit power trimming switch is manually switched to an Ng trimming gear; and after the engine electronic controller receives the Ng trimming gear information, Ng trimming is carried out.
